Predetermined Overhead Rate
A rate calculated by dividing the estimated total manufacturing overhead cost by the estimated job base for a specific period, used to allocate overhead costs to products.

Overhead Variances
Differences between the actual overhead costs incurred and the overhead costs that were budgeted or expected.
